FashionUnited in Novi, Michigan, is hiring for a fashion sales role where you will represent Coach as a brand ambassador. Candidates should have at least 1 year of luxury retail sales experience and a strong understanding of fashion trends. The position demands excellent customer service and sales skills to foster lasting client relationships and drive sales.
The role also involves completing daily operational tasks and maintaining store standards while ensuring a collaborative environment. A range of benefits including medical, dental, and 401(k) will be provided.
Coach is a global fashion house founded in New York in 1941. Inspired by the vision of Creative Director Stuart Vevers and the inclusive and courageous spirit of our hometown, we make beautiful things, crafted to last—for you to be yourself in. Coach is part of the Tapestry portfolio – a global house of brands committed to stretching what’s possible.
